Scaffolding itself is basically a temporary structure that is built out of metal tubes, boards & fittings, which are all locked together to create a strong working platform. A decent set-up will give tradespeople enough room to move safely around, stack materials, and actually focus on the job in hand rather than having to worry about their footing. Internal scaffolding structures are a little different & are frequently overlooked. These scaffolds are used inside properties for working on things such as high ceilings, stairwells, or major refurb jobs. Instead of being erected outside, the scaffold sits neatly indoors, giving safe access without causing damage to floors or walls. Safety is always the big talking point with scaffolding, and so it should be. Proper guard rails, toe boards & solid decking all help to reduce the risk of accidents.
